> Hi All...well, still can't figure out where the
> problem is !....I know its probably my fault that
> the windows and locks are 'dead', since I shorted
> the Circuit breaker under the drivers-side kick
> panel while trying to tighten up the wires that i
> thought were the cause of the headlights & radio
> suddenly not working...well, the radio & headlights
> are working (never found out what the cause was) and
> the windows & locks are NOT, which is not a bad
> circuit breaker (I put new ones in) and I am about
> ready to start digging into the wiring harness to
> trace the GREEN wire that was on the 15Amp terminal
> portion of the breaker.......has anyone figured out
> WHERE this wire goes to?...the FSM diagrams are not
> much help at all! I surely could be reading the
> diagrams wrong, but i don't even SEE a GREEN wire
> (about a 14gauge) shown as being connected to this
> breaker!,,,does anyone know from experience where
> this wire goes to???....when I have the battery
> connected up, (using a 12volt tester) I see a good
> bright light on the 15A breaker terminal WITHOUT the
> Green wire-circuit connected...soon as I connect
> this GREEN wire, and whatever it is wired to, the
> light is hardly visable so I am assuming the GREEN
> wire circuit is loading down the system.......maybe
> there is a fusable-link someplace in there that I
> 'toasted' when I shorted the breaker teminals(??)...
> ....just wanted to ask if anyone had any experience
> with this breaker and the wires it feeds before I
> start opening up the harness-tape....
